在数字货币领域,以太坊(Ethereum)作为一个获得广泛认可的智能合约平台,其钱包功能和合约管理的相关性成为用户必须面对的问题之一。随着越来越多的人参与以太坊生态,理解如何创建和使用以太坊钱包,不仅仅局限于简单的存储和交易操作,还包括如何与合约互动和添加合约地址成为一项重要的技能。本文将深入探讨在创建以太坊钱包时是否需要添加合约地址,以及其他相关内容。
以太坊钱包是一个应用程序或者工具,用于存储你的以太坊(ETH)及其代币。简单来说,以太坊钱包可以分为两种:热钱包和冷钱包。热钱包是在线钱包,方便快捷,适合日常交易;冷钱包是离线的,通常以硬件形式保存,安全性更高,适合长期存储。
以太坊钱包不仅能存储以太币(ETH),还可以存储以太坊网络上的各种代币,包括ERC20和ERC721等标准的代币。用户进行交易、发送和接收代币、与智能合约互动等功能均依赖于以太坊钱包的支持。
在以太坊网络中,合约地址是部署在以太坊区块链上的智能合约的唯一标识符。每一个智能合约都会被分配一个地址,用户可以通过这个地址与合约进行交互。合约地址类似于银行账户号码,人们可以通过这个地址向合约发送交易,或是从合约中获取信息。
答案是:不需要!创建以太坊钱包本身并不涉及添加合约地址。用户在创建自己的以太坊钱包时,只需要生成一个账户地址即可,用于接收和发送ETH以及代币。
合约地址的添加主要是在你需要与某个具体的智能合约进行互动时。例如,如果你想参与某个去中心化金融(DeFi)项目的流动性挖矿,那么你需要在你的钱包中找到合约地址,以便与该合约进行通信和交易。
1. **获取合约地址**:首先,你需要获取你希望与之互动的智能合约的地址。通常该地址会在项目方的官方网站、社交媒体或社区论坛上公布。
2. **添加合约到钱包**:以太坊部分钱包支持用户手动添加合约,这样用户可以直接查看该合约所拥有的代币信息。在钱包中寻找“添加代币”或“导入合约”等功能,输入合约地址及其他必要信息即可。
连接和使用不明的合约地址时,一定要小心。以下是确保合约地址安全的几点建议:
在选择以太坊钱包时,用户需要根据自身的需求来考虑多个因素,包括安全性、易用性、功能齐全程度以及兼容性等。首先,安全性是一项基本要求,用户可以考虑使用硬件钱包,例如Ledger或Trezor等,以保障资金的安全。其次,对于新手用户,建议选择用户界面友好的热钱包,如MetaMask或Trust Wallet,它们通常会提供良好的用户体验,帮助用户快速掌握操作。此外,还要关注钱包是否支持ERC20及ERC721等代币的处理功能,对需要频繁交易的用户来说,钱包的交易效率也是一个重要因素。若用户打算频繁参与DeFi项目、NFT市场等操作,则建议选择一个功能更全且支持直接与合约互动的钱包。
向以太坊钱包转账ETH或代币的过程相对简单。首先,确保你已有一个以太坊钱包,并获得它的地址。然后在另一个钱包或交易所中选择“发送”或“转账”功能,输入你的钱包地址和转账金额。有些交易所可能会要求你确认交易,因此请确保你的转账信息是正确的。此外,也需注意一些交易所对于ETH和代币的最小转账限制。如果是转账代币,务必检查接收地址是否已正确添加相关代币的合约信息。完成步骤后,根据网络的拥堵情况,转账可能需要几分钟到几小时不等的时间才能完成。在等待的时候,可以通过区块浏览器查询交易状态。
智能合约和中央化交易所的主要区别体现在去中心化与中心化方面。智能合约是基于区块链技术,允许用户在没有中介参与的情况下进行交易、交换和验证。由于智能合约是自动执行的,可以减少人为干预,增加透明度和安全性。然而,中央化交易所,则是由一家集中管理的公司运行,用户的资金存放在交易所的热钱包中,相较于智能合约,中心化交易存在被黑客攻击和管理风险的潜在隐患。此外,用户在中央化交易所通常需要完成身份验证和提供个人信息,而智能合约则相对匿名。尽管中心化交易可以提供更快的交易体验,但对于希望参与更为去中心化和匿名化交易的用户,智能合约提供了另一种选择。
以太坊网络的可扩展性是指网络处理交易的能力。由于技术限制,当网络特别繁忙时,用户可能会面临较高的交易手续费(Gas费)和较慢的交易确认时间。这对钱包用户的使用场景有直接影响,比如在交通高峰期,用户在进行转账或与合约互动时可能要支付更高的费用。因此,用户选择钱包时要查看其交易费用,并考虑在低谷期进行重要交易。同时,去中心化金融(DeFi)应用的兴起,也使得以太坊面临更大的压力,传统的以太坊网络逐渐显露出局限性。为此,许多钱包开发者正在考虑整合Layer 2解决方案,提高网络的交易效率,以提升用户体验。
通过以上问题的回答,我们可以看到,用户在创建以太坊钱包及进行合约互动时,了解合约地址与其相关操作的必要性是不可或缺的。希望本篇文章能对您在以太坊钱包的使用中有所帮助。
leave a reply